ComhaltasLive #327-7: A selection of jigs from Gerry O’Connor
Master of the banjo Gerry O’Connor from Nenagh, Co. Tipperary plays a selection of jigs. The recording was made in Nenagh, Co. Tipperary on 19th October 2004 shortly after the launch of Gerry’s second CD entitled “There’s no place like home”.
